Eye On Growth: BROADWOOD PARTNERS LP Adds $13.70M Of Staar Surgical Stock To Portfolio

Comments
Loading...

A notable insider purchase on December 1, was reported by BROADWOOD PARTNERS LP, 10% Owner at Staar Surgical STAA, based on the most recent SEC filing.

What Happened: A Form 4 filing from the U.S. Securities and Exchange Commission on Friday showed that LP purchased 434,991 shares of Staar Surgical. The total transaction amounted to $13,703,830.

In the Friday's morning session, Staar Surgical's shares are currently trading at $31.35, experiencing a down of 0.03%.

About Staar Surgical

Staar Surgical Co is a manufacturer of lenses. It designs, develops, manufactures, and sells implantable lenses for the eye and delivery systems used to deliver the lenses into the eye. The company also make lenses which are used in surgery that treats cataracts. The company offers products are ICLs used in refractive surgery and IOLs used in cataract surgery. The company generated sales are from the ophthalmic surgical product segment.

Financial Insights: Staar Surgical

Positive Revenue Trend: Examining Staar Surgical's financials over 3 months reveals a positive narrative. The company achieved a noteworthy revenue growth rate of 5.6% as of 30 September, 2023, showcasing a substantial increase in top-line earnings. When compared to others in the Health Care sector, the company faces challenges, achieving a growth rate lower than the average among peers.

Navigating Financial Profits:

  • Gross Margin: Achieving a high gross margin of 79.24%, the company performs well in terms of cost management and profitability within its sector.

  • Earnings per Share (EPS): With an EPS below industry norms, Staar Surgical exhibits below-average bottom-line performance with a current EPS of 0.1.

Debt Management: Staar Surgical's debt-to-equity ratio is below the industry average at 0.09, reflecting a lower dependency on debt financing and a more conservative financial approach.

Financial Valuation Breakdown:

  • Price to Earnings (P/E) Ratio: A higher-than-average P/E ratio of 82.53 suggests caution, as the stock may be overvalued in the eyes of investors.

  • Price to Sales (P/S) Ratio: With a higher-than-average P/S ratio of 5.0, Staar Surgical's stock is perceived as being overvalued in the market, particularly in relation to sales performance.

  • EV/EBITDA Analysis (Enterprise Value to its Earnings Before Interest, Taxes, Depreciation & Amortization): Staar Surgical's EV/EBITDA ratio stands at 57.56, surpassing industry benchmarks. This places the company in a position with a higher-than-average market valuation.

Market Capitalization Analysis: Falling below industry benchmarks, the company's market capitalization reflects a reduced size compared to peers. This positioning may be influenced by factors such as growth expectations or operational capacity.

Now trade stocks online commission free with Charles Schwab, a trusted and complete investment firm.

Illuminating the Importance of Insider Transactions

Insightful as they may be, insider transactions should be considered alongside a thorough examination of other investment criteria.

When discussing legal matters, the term "insider" refers to any officer, director, or beneficial owner holding more than ten percent of a company's equity securities, as stipulated in Section 12 of the Securities Exchange Act of 1934. This includes executives in the c-suite and significant hedge funds. Such insiders are required to report their transactions through a Form 4 filing, which must be completed within two business days of the transaction.

A new purchase by a company insider is a indication that they anticipate the stock will rise.

On the other hand, insider sells may not necessarily indicate a bearish view and can be motivated by various factors.

Essential Transaction Codes Unveiled

Navigating through the landscape of transactions, investors often prioritize those unfolding in the open market, precisely detailed in Table I of the Form 4 filing. A P in Box 3 denotes a purchase, while S signifies a sale. Transaction code C signals the conversion of an option, and transaction code A denotes a grant, award, or other acquisition of securities from the company.

Check Out The Full List Of Staar Surgical's Insider Trades.

This article was generated by Benzinga's automated content engine and reviewed by an editor.

Overview Rating:
Speculative
37.5%
Technicals Analysis
66
0100
Financials Analysis
20
0100
Overview
Market News and Data brought to you by Benzinga APIs

Posted In:
Benzinga simplifies the market for smarter investing

Trade confidently with insights and alerts from analyst ratings, free reports and breaking news that affects the stocks you care about.

Join Now: Free!